Double Glazing Windows Maidenhead

New windows can make your home more comfortable as well as reduce your energy costs. Double glazing can cut down on your energy costs and improve your home's efficiency.

Double glazing is composed of two glass panes with an empty space (known as the warm edge) between them. This keeps heat inside and keeps it from escaping.

UPVC

UPVC double glazing windows are a good option for homeowners looking to improve the energy efficiency of their home. These uPVC windows have two panes of glass that are separated by a spacer bar , and filled with an insulating gas to create a glazed unit (IGU) that prevents heat loss from your home.

You can find a range of styles and colors to be suitable for any space, such as bay, bow and French style windows. These uPVC windows are ideal to make the most of outdoor spaces and can be fitted in a variety of different sizes.

A tilt and turn window is another popular option. These uPVC windows can be swiveled to allow ventilation and open outwards. There are also different designs like casement or sash.

These windows are a very popular option for homeowners. They are simple to clean and add a touch of luxury to any home. They also have draughtproofing, which helps keep your home comfortable and warm.

Aluminium

Aluminium is the most suitable choice for those looking for a durable, low-maintenance window solution that is also eco-friendly. It has a slim profile that helps increase the amount of glass and improve natural light in your home.

Aluminium is less susceptible to rotting and warping than uPVC. Aluminium is also extremely durable, which means it will last for years without needing to be maintained.

Based on the style of window you select The double glazing windows made of aluminum in Maidenhead will help keep your energy costs lower by keeping your home warm during the winter months and cool in summer. This means that you're saving money on your energy bills and lessening your carbon footprint.

There are numerous options for aluminium windows. However, the majority of them use the same design process and comply with the current building regulations. They will be equipped with thermal breaks that stop heat transfer from the outside to the inside.

Frames are made by extruders. They can be anodized or coated with colours that are applied by color applicators. This process is usually done in controlled environments to ensure that the final product is uniform.

Wood

Wooden double-glazed windows are an excellent way to add design and warmth to your home. Not only do they look nice, but they are also extremely durable and will last for Maidenhead Door Panels many years to be.

Many companies install bay, casement and sash windows. They will also offer various styles and designs to choose from.

The type of wood used for windows made of wood can also affect their longevity and durability. There are two kinds of wood you can choose from: softwood and hardwood. Each has its own advantages and disadvantages.

A hardwood frame will give your wooden window a classic appearance. These frames are more durable because they are resistant to cracking and being warped in cold temperatures and are more resistant to damage.

Another benefit of choosing hardwood frames over softwood frames is that they are more environmentally friendly. They are made of renewable materials that can be recycled or reused whenever needed.

Wood is also an excellent insulation. It can help keep your home warm in winter and cool during summer. The best wood for insulating windows is oak or cherry as they have low U-value (which is the measure of how well a window can block heat flow).

They are also a great option when you are looking to make your home more energy efficient. They will save you money on heating costs and are more eco-friendly than a uPVC-based system.

It is essential to select the right company to fit your window frames made of wood properly. A poor fitting can cause your windows to stop opening or not retaining their seals.

This can cause condensation and lower energy efficiency. It is also an ideal idea to have the seals replaced or repaired if they are causing any problems.

A company that provides a guarantee on sealed units is recommended if are looking to purchase a wood-framed window. This will ensure that should there are any issues in the future, they will be fixed for you by the company.

Double-glazed windows are the ideal way to boost insulation. It can keep the heat from the sun in summer and retain it in winter. The glass is backed by an air space that acts as an insulation between the two glass panes and it can be filled with an inert gas such as argon or krypton. Argon can help seal the air gap between the two panes of glass, thereby increasing their resistance to heat transfer.
